Home disinfectants


The most cost-effective home disinfectant is chlorine bleach  which is effective against most common pathogens, including disinfectant-resistant organisms such as tuberculosis , hepatitis B and C, fungi, and antibiotic-resistant strains of staphylococcus and enterococcus. It has disinfectant action against some parasitic organisms. As with most disinfectants, the area requiring disinfection should be cleaned before the application of the chlorine bleach, as the presence of organic materials may inactivate chlorine bleach.
